Output 72d1fb2083976b9c4a03aea2ce44bceaf9ec8b4f3e9f2bddd7ea8a7c085edc66:4

value
17207398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3b82b7389dc0d512e1f1c1857db9ebe6b7079a4 OP_EQUALVERIFY OP_CHECKSIG
address
1PDfpxDpevPCB6tq3ckng5SjCDJYMYw7ym
transaction
72d1fb2083976b9c4a03aea2ce44bceaf9ec8b4f3e9f2bddd7ea8a7c085edc66
spent
true